Oona's Blackguard feels like it could be another good lord effect for your Faeries, given most of them appear to be Rogues. Talion, the Kindly Lord is just generically good; the life loss really adds up over time, plus he helps keep your grip full.
My deck utilizes a variety of Coastal Piracy effects as my main source of card draw. Not sure if you want to go that wide/explosive, but man drawing that many cards is sweet.
Given that you already have Force of Will and Fierce Guardianship, might as well add Force of Negation too in order to complete the trifecta.
Tegwyll is inherently wrath insurance on his own, but have you considered supplementing that with graveyard recursion? Oversold Cemetery, Patriarch's Bidding, etc.
I don't think you have enough Wizards for it it, but man using Riptide Laboratory on Faerie Harbinger or Mistbind Clique feels disgustingly good. Snapcaster Mage and Spellseeker are a couple of good generic cards that could maybe find a home too.
